The Early Days of NFT Minting
- Ethereum and the ERC-721 Standard
- Ethereum introduced ERC-721, the first standard for NFTs, enabling unique digital asset ownership.
- Early platforms like CryptoPunks and CryptoKitties pioneered NFT minting but suffered from high gas fees and network congestion.
- NFT Marketplaces as Minting Hubs
- Platforms like OpenSea, Rarible, and Foundation allowed creators to mint NFTs without coding knowledge.
- Minting on these platforms was convenient but came with centralized control and marketplace fees.
The Rise of Advanced NFT Minting Technologies
- Smart Contract-Based Minting
- Custom NFT smart contracts allow creators to deploy their own collections, offering full control over royalties and metadata.
- Platforms like Manifold and Zora provide creator-first minting tools, reducing reliance on centralized marketplaces.
- Layer 2 Solutions for Lower Gas Fees
- Polygon, Arbitrum, and Optimism enable gas-efficient minting by processing transactions off-chain before settling on Ethereum.
- Layer 2 minting helps reduce costs and increase scalability, making NFT creation more accessible.
- Lazy Minting (Mint on Demand)
- Lazy minting allows NFTs to be created only when purchased, eliminating upfront gas costs for creators.
- OpenSea and Rarible offer lazy minting as a default option for cost-conscious creators.
- Gasless Minting Innovations
- Zero-cost minting platforms like Immutable X and Mintable leverage Layer 2 scaling to remove transaction fees altogether.
- On-Chain vs. Off-Chain Metadata Storage
- Newer NFT projects store metadata fully on-chain, ensuring permanent ownership and immutability, unlike earlier models that relied on off-chain storage (IPFS, AWS, or Google Drive).
How Businesses and Creators Can Leverage Smart Contract Innovations
- Deploy Custom NFT Smart Contracts
- Using Manifold, Thirdweb, or OpenZeppelin, businesses can create fully customizable NFT collections with on-chain royalties and permissions.
- Integrate NFTs into Web3 Ecosystems
- NFT smart contracts now power gaming, metaverse assets, and token-gated communities, expanding beyond simple collectibles.
- Use Programmable NFTs for Dynamic Utility
- Smart contract upgrades allow NFTs to evolve over time, enabling real-time metadata updates, staking rewards, and cross-chain compatibility.
Future Trends in NFT Minting
- AI-Generated NFTs and Dynamic Metadata
- AI-powered generative art collections will allow for interactive and evolving NFTs based on real-world data inputs.
- Cross-Chain NFT Minting
- More platforms will support multi-chain minting, allowing NFTs to be moved across different blockchains seamlessly.
- Decentralized NFT Marketplaces and Protocols
- Smart contract-driven NFT trading will replace traditional marketplaces, reducing platform fees and increasing creator control.
- Physical-Backed NFTs (Phygital Assets)
- NFTs will represent real-world assets like fashion, real estate, and luxury goods, blending digital and physical ownership.
